Longview to Odessa

Updated: 28 May 2026

The drive from Longview to Odessa is approximately 630 kilometers and takes about seven hours and thirty minutes. You will travel west on I-20, which takes you through the heart of Texas. Odessa is located in the Permian Basin and is known for its oil and gas industry. It offers a unique look at the history and economy of West Texas. This route is a straightforward drive along a major interstate highway.

Total Distance: 630 km driving distance; 550 km straight-line air distance.

Travel Tips
  • Truck Traffic
    Be prepared for heavy truck traffic on I-20; maintain a safe distance.
  • Fuel
    Fill up in larger towns, as gas stations can be busy in the Permian Basin.
  • Navigation
    Download maps for offline use, as cellular service can be spotty.
  • Weather
    Check the forecast for severe weather, as the region is prone to thunderstorms.
  • Hydration
    The air is dry; drink plenty of water throughout the drive.
Safety Tips
  • Road Safety
    Stay alert for wildlife, especially at dawn and dusk.
  • Emergency
    Carry extra water and snacks in your car in case of a breakdown.
  • Night Driving
    Avoid driving at night due to the risk of wildlife on the road.
  • Stay Alert
    Take regular breaks to avoid driver fatigue on this long journey.

Things to Do in Odessa
1
Odessa Meteor Crater
One of the largest meteor craters in the United States. It is a fascinating geological site.
2
Ellen Noël Art Museum
Features a diverse collection of art and history exhibits in a beautiful setting.
3
Presidential Archives and Leadership Library
A unique museum dedicated to the history of the American presidency.
4
Stonehenge Replica
A fun and unique roadside attraction located on the campus of the University of Texas of the Permian Basin.
